### EXIF Scrub Verification — Pinefield Uploads

Before approving changes to the scrubber, confirm the following: all JPEG and HEIC uploads pass through strip_meta() prior to storage; GPS, serial, and owner tags must be absent in the output fixture set. Run the golden-file diff in tests/exif — any new passthrough tag fails review. Note that WebP handling was added recently and has its own fixture directory. When filing the review, cite the exact scrubber build, which is recorded below.

build token for tawip-yageg: htk9_92ac43d42

**Alert: tailfox CLI — tail session failures**

The tailfox CLI is failing to open tail sessions against the Greymarsh log brokers. Error rate above 30% for 15 minutes. Release impact: deploy verification relies on live tails, so holds may be needed. Workaround: use the batch-pull mode until sessions recover. Triage steps and current broker status are tracked on the page below.

dashboard of bajef-bageg = https://confluence.lumiclabs.internal/browse/browse/pages/display/93ae

Subject: DR drill — Quillstack catalogue import failover

Hi,

Next Thursday we're running the quarterly disaster-recovery drill for the Quillstack library catalogue import. We'll simulate a total loss of the primary import node and fail over to the Harbrook standby. As release manager, your part is to confirm the standby picks up the MARC batch queue and that version tags stay consistent. No customer impact expected. To unlock the standby's import credentials during the drill, you'll need the recovery passphrase included below.

recovery phrase for tagug-yagug: lamox-gilax-keleth-gilath